What does aquaporin refer to in the context of kidney function?

Aquaporin refers to water channels that facilitate the reabsorption of water in the kidneys. These proteins are integral to the membranes of kidney cells, particularly in the renal tubules, where they play a crucial role in maintaining the body's water balance. In the nephron, specifically in the collecting ducts and proximal convoluted tubules, aquaporins allow for the selective passage of water while preventing the movement of solutes. This mechanism is vital for the kidneys' ability to concentrate urine and regulate hydration levels in the body.

Through the action of aquaporins, kidneys can respond to the body's hydration needs, reabsorbing more water when the body is dehydrated and conversely allowing for more water excretion when hydration levels are adequate. Understanding the function of aquaporins is essential for comprehending how the kidneys perform their critical role in water homeostasis.
